Produktbeschreibung
Globalisation processes continues to evolve in the modern world. For 2017 a package of measures, as a part of international agreements between different states, is planned for implementation to address tax abuses. It is certain that such measures are important, as they contribute to fair taxation, reduction of tax evasion, money laundering and terrorist financing. The fundamental principle of measures to be implemented is a full and mutual openness of states parties, which have concluded international agreements in the area of tax and bank information exchange, to exchange information regarding organizations and foreign citizens. There are different opinions regarding this concept, in particular on the rights of an owner of assets (money in the account, real estate, shares, etc.). However in general the regulation should find balance between human rights and global state financial and legal interests. Human Rights Resource Center with the partnership of NGO Lawyers Club has developed recommendations for NGOs to minimize the risks of accountability for violation of the legislation.
Autorenporträt
Dr. Maria Kanevskaya is Russian civil society activist and human rights lawyer. At the moment she serves as coordinator of the NGO Lawyers¿ Club, where she has been working since 2014. However, a major place in her career is occupied by the Human Rights Resource Center that she founded in 2008.
